commission noun

  /kəˈmɪʃən/
  • A body or group of people, officially tasked with carrying out a particular function.
kommission
  • A fee charged by an agent or broker for carrying out a transaction.
provision, kommission, avgift
  • A sending or mission (to do or accomplish something).
uppdrag

commission verb

  /kəˈmɪʃən/
  • (transitive) To place an order for (often a piece of art).
beställa, ge beställning på
  • (transitive) To send or officially charge someone or some group to do something.
ge i uppdrag, uppdra

commissioning noun

  • The process of assuring that all systems and components of a major piece of equipment, a process, a building or similar are designed, installed and tested according to the operational requirements of the owner or final client.
kommissionering
